SK hynix Approves $38 Billion Memory Expansion as AI Demand Strains Supply

Rendering of the M17 fab that SK hynix plans to build in Cheongju. Image: SK hynix

SK hynix approved about $38.1 billion for two memory fabs, but new HBM and NAND capacity may not ease AI-driven supply pressure until 2029.

AI’s memory hunger is pushing SK hynix into a massive expansion, with the chipmaker committing about $38.1 billion to two new factories in South Korea.

SK hynix said its board approved 54.3 trillion won (approx. $38.1 billion) for two new semiconductor fabrication plants, as demand for memory chips used in AI infrastructure continues to climb.

The company will spend 35.2 trillion won (approx. $24.8 billion) on the Y2 fab in Yongin and 19.1 trillion won (approx. $13.5 billion) on the M17 facility in Cheongju. The investment is part of SK hynix’s longer-term plan to expand production capacity as AI data centers consume increasing amounts of advanced memory.

Market research firm Omdia expects global demand for both DRAM and NAND memory to grow at a compound annual rate of 19% from last year through 2030, according to SK hynix. The company said the investment followed a detailed review of market demand.

HBM and NAND take center stage

The Yongin Y2 facility will focus on DRAM, including high-bandwidth memory (HBM), which is critical to AI accelerators and data center systems. Construction is scheduled to begin in July 2027, with the first cleanroom expected to open in June 2029.

On the other hand, the Cheongju M17 fab will manufacture NAND memory, which is increasingly being used in enterprise solid-state drives and AI infrastructure. Construction is expected to begin in February 2027, with the first cleanroom targeted for December 2028.

SK hynix selected Cheongju partly because its existing M11, M12 and M15 fabs provide established power and water infrastructure, allowing the company to build out production more quickly. The company is also accelerating development of its Yongin Semiconductor Cluster. It plans to complete four fabs there by 2033, 12 years earlier than the original 2045 target.

A bet on a longer AI boom

The scale and timing of the investment suggest that SK hynix expects the AI-driven memory surge to be a long-term shift rather than a short-lived cycle.

That is a significant bet. The new fabs will not add substantial capacity immediately, meaning they are unlikely to ease the current supply pressure. Counterpoint Research’s Neil Shah told CNBC that the expansion is intended to serve demand from 2029 onward, while memory prices could remain elevated through 2028 if demand continues to outpace planned capacity.

At the same time, SK hynix faces growing competition. Samsung reclaimed the top position in the DRAM market during the second quarter, according to Counterpoint Research, while Samsung, Micron and China’s CXMT are also expanding capacity.

SK hynix said it plans to build the facilities according to its master schedule but add cleanroom space and production equipment progressively as customer demand develops.

What it means for AI and consumers

For AI companies, the expansion should eventually provide more capacity for HBM and other advanced memory products. That could help chipmakers and data center operators secure the components needed to expand AI computing infrastructure.

For consumers, however, the near-term picture is less encouraging. Strong AI data center demand is directing investment and manufacturing resources toward higher-value memory products, while new capacity will take years to arrive. That could keep pressure on memory prices for PCs, smartphones, and other electronics.
